Function Args
Provides an AppSync Function.
Example Usage
package generated_program;
import com.pulumi.Context;
import com.pulumi.Pulumi;
import com.pulumi.core.Output;
import com.pulumi.aws.appsync.GraphQLApi;
import com.pulumi.aws.appsync.GraphQLApiArgs;
import com.pulumi.aws.appsync.DataSource;
import com.pulumi.aws.appsync.DataSourceArgs;
import com.pulumi.aws.appsync.inputs.DataSourceHttpConfigArgs;
import com.pulumi.aws.appsync.Function;
import com.pulumi.aws.appsync.FunctionArgs;
import java.util.List;
import java.util.ArrayList;
import java.util.Map;
import java.io.File;
import java.nio.file.Files;
import java.nio.file.Paths;
public class App {
public static void main(String[] args) {
Pulumi.run(App::stack);
}
public static void stack(Context ctx) {
var exampleGraphQLApi = new GraphQLApi("exampleGraphQLApi", GraphQLApiArgs.builder()
.authenticationType("API_KEY")
.schema("""
type Mutation {
putPost(id: ID!, title: String!): Post
}
type Post {
id: ID!
title: String!
}
type Query {
singlePost(id: ID!): Post
}
schema {
query: Query
mutation: Mutation
}
""")
.build());
var exampleDataSource = new DataSource("exampleDataSource", DataSourceArgs.builder()
.apiId(exampleGraphQLApi.id())
.name("example")
.type("HTTP")
.httpConfig(DataSourceHttpConfigArgs.builder()
.endpoint("http://example.com")
.build())
.build());
var exampleFunction = new Function("exampleFunction", FunctionArgs.builder()
.apiId(exampleGraphQLApi.id())
.dataSource(exampleDataSource.name())
.name("example")
.requestMappingTemplate("""
{
"version": "2018-05-29",
"method": "GET",
"resourcePath": "/",
"params":{
"headers": $utils.http.copyheaders($ctx.request.headers)
}
}
""")
.responseMappingTemplate("""
#if($ctx.result.statusCode == 200)
$ctx.result.body
#else
$utils.appendError($ctx.result.body, $ctx.result.statusCode)
#end
""")
.build());
}
}

Import
aws_appsync_function
can be imported using the AppSync API ID and Function ID separated by -
, e.g.,
$ pulumi import aws:appsync/function:Function example xxxxx-yyyyy

Properties
Function data source name.
Function description.
Version of the request mapping template. Currently the supported value is 2018-05-29
. Does not apply when specifying code
.
Maximum batching size for a resolver. Valid values are between 0
and 2000
.
Function request mapping template. Functions support only the 2018-05-29 version of the request mapping template.
Function response mapping template.
Describes a runtime used by an AWS AppSync pipeline resolver or AWS AppSync function. Specifies the name and version of the runtime to use. Note that if a runtime is specified, code must also be specified. See Runtime.
Describes a Sync configuration for a resolver. See Sync Config.
